What Is Travel Speed?

Travel speed in welding is defined as the speed at which the welding torch or electrode moves along the joint being welded. It might sound straightforward, but this tiny detail holds immense significance in producing quality welds. Think of it like driving a car—going too fast can lead to accidents, while driving too slowly can lead to frustration. In welding, getting that speed just right impacts the integrity of the weld.

Why Does Travel Speed Matter?

Let’s get into the nitty-gritty. Travel speed plays an essential role in the quality of your weld. Here’s how:

  • Penetration: Fast travel speeds often lead to inadequate penetration, which basically means that your weld isn’t bonding the base metals together effectively. Imagine laying plaster on a wall; if you just smear it on, it won’t stick!
  • Heat Input: On the other hand, going too slow can crank up the heat input, leading to deformities in the metal. It’s akin to overcooking a steak—something that should be beautifully seared can quickly turn into a charred mess!
  • Weld Bead Appearance: Not only that, but speed also directly influences the appearance of the weld bead. A well-executed bead should look smooth and clean, like icing on a well-decorated cake. A poorly executed one? Well, that’s a recipe for disaster.

Balance is Key

So, the crux of the matter is all about balance. It's like trying to carry two heavy bags. You don't want to rush and drop one, nor should you drag your feet and tire yourself out. Finding that sweet spot in travel speed ensures proper fusion of the base metals and filler material.

You might find yourself wondering, how do I figure out the right travel speed? Don't fret! It's a bit of trial and error and adjusting based on the materials and conditions you are working with.
